Jefferson Finis Davis (1808-1889) was born in Kentucky and grew up in Mississippi. He was elected to Congress from Mississippi in 1845 and, later, to the Senate. President Franklin Pierce appointed him Secretary of War in 1853, but during the growing sectional crisis, Davis returned to the Senate and followed his state when it seceded. When the Confederacy crumbled, Davis was captured and spent two years in Federal prison.
